Daily Log

June 21, 2005

Excavation continued in locus 2 .  The last of the stumps was eliminated.  Approximately two bowls (24 cm. in diameter, 7 cm. in depth) of terracotta fragments were recovered.  Eighteen fragments of bone and teeth were found.  Forty-seven pottery sherds were found (Impasto body:  34, Impasto rim:  6, Impasto handle:  4, Fine Impasto body:  3).  The trench was lowered approximately 10 cm.  An impasto tondo with an incision was recovered (Special Find #1).
